What is the purpose of sodium bicarbonate in treating metabolic acidosis?

Sodium bicarbonate serves a critical role in treating metabolic acidosis by helping to neutralize acidity in the bloodstream. In conditions characterized by metabolic acidosis, there is an excess of hydrogen ions (H⁺) in the body, which leads to a drop in blood pH, making the blood more acidic. Sodium bicarbonate, being a bicarbonate salt, acts as a buffer. When it is administered, it dissociates into sodium ions (Na⁺) and bicarbonate ions (HCO₃⁻).

The bicarbonate ions can combine with excess hydrogen ions to form carbonic acid, which further dissociates into carbon dioxide and water. This reaction effectively reduces the concentration of hydrogen ions in the bloodstream, leading to an increase in pH and a reduction in overall acidity. Therefore, the primary purpose of sodium bicarbonate in this context is to correct the acid-base imbalance by increasing the bicarbonate level, which helps to restore normal blood pH levels.

Understanding this mechanism is crucial for effectively managing patients with metabolic acidosis and can significantly impact their overall treatment outcomes.
